Transaction 39e4aa30a2fabe104076035979c8f6640fad613e710e4b737621ea79f71accae

1 Input
2 Outputs
  • 39e4aa30a2fabe104076035979c8f6640fad613e710e4b737621ea79f71accae:0
  • value  303320
    address  3NJk1b4skH2KbeBR76XVwTLNWkUgw7rQn1
  • 39e4aa30a2fabe104076035979c8f6640fad613e710e4b737621ea79f71accae:1
  • value  42070982
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d